Enhancing Semantic Relatedness for Low-Resource African Languages via Transfer Learning and M2M-100 Data Augmentation # Semantic Relatedness for Low-Resource African Languages This repository contains the implementation and results for the project: **_Enhancing Semantic Relatedness for Low-Resource African Languages via Transfer Learning and M2M-100 Data Augmentation_** The project investigates scalable and effective approaches for improving Semantic Textual Relatedness (STR) in low-resource African languages through transfer learning and multilingual machine translation–based augmentation. ## Key Features - Three African Languages: Hausa, Kinyarwanda, Afrikaans - SemRel2024 Dataset: Standardized benchmark for semantic relatedness - Transfer Learning: Fine-tuning African-centric models (AfriBERTa, AfroXLMR) - M2M-100 Augmentation: MAFAND-MT back-translation pipeline - Significant Gains: Up to **1167% improvement** over baseline models ## 📚 Research Questions **RQ1:** Which transfer-learning methods (AfriBERTa vs AfroXLMR) yield the best STR performance for African languages? **RQ2:** How effective is M2M-100 back-translation in improving model accuracy and robustness under low-resource constraints? ## 📊 Results Summary | Language | Baseline (XLM-R) | Fine-tuned (AfroXLMR) | M2M-100 Augmented | Improvement | |--------------|------------------|-------------------------|-------------------|-------------| | Afrikaans | 0.4016 | 0.4085 | 0.6452 | +60.66% | | Hausa | 0.1247 | 0.6518 | 0.6389 | +412.51% | | Kinyarwanda | 0.0425 | 0.5390 | 0.6456 | +1417.76% | **Metric:** Spearman Correlation Coefficient (ρ) ## 📁 Project Structure ``` ├── COS802_Project_Code.ipynb ├── COS_802_Proposal_Final_u25743695.pdf ├── IEEE_Paper.tex ├── README.md │ ├── results/ │ ├── all_results_mafand.csv │ ├── statistical_tests_mafand.csv │ └── final_comparison_table_mafand.csv │ ├── visualizations/ │ ├── comparison_bar_chart_mafand.html │ ├── improvement …
